We have compared the anaesthetic and analgesic efficacy of levobupivacaine with that of racemic bupivacaine in 66 male patients undergoing ambulatory primary inguinal herniorrhaphy. Patients were allocated randomly in a double-blind manner to local infiltration anaesthesia (0.25% w/v 50 ml) with either racemic bupivacaine (n = 33) or levobupivacaine (n = 33). BACKGROUND Preincisional local anesthetic infiltration at the surgical site is a therapeutic option for postoperative pain relief for pediatric inguinal hernia. Additionally, tramadol has been used as an analgesic for postoperative pain in children. Recently, the local anesthetic effects of tramadol have been reported. PURPOSE Urinary retention is one of the most common complications contributing to surgical procedures. Recent studies have shown the benefits of alpha-adrenergic blockers in preventing post-operative urinary retention (POUR).
